Gen Z was tricky how exactly we time, says Tinder declaration

According to Tinder’s Future of Dating Statement 2023, you will find inserted a matchmaking renaissance, determined by Gen Z’s need to disrupt dating and relationship norms carved out by earlier years. 75 per cent of Gen Z getting they are tricky dating and you can relationship standards that were passed down on it, the new declaration located. 18–twenty-five year olds make up more fifty percent out-of Tinder’s associate foot, according to the dating app. They aren’t alone in the taking that relationship people try shifting. More than 1 / 2 of more than millennials interviewed believe dating is actually healthier getting 18–twenty-five seasons olds than it actually was after they had been you to definitely years. 73 percent out of 33–38 year olds asserted that matchmaking games, such as for instance to tackle hard to get otherwise giving mixed signals had been widely reported to be regular after they had been old anywhere between 18 and you may twenty-five. The latest statement and additionally unearthed that 18–twenty five 12 months olds try thirty two % less likely to ghost individuals than individuals more than 33. Gone are the days regarding prepared circumstances if you don’t days to answer a message playing they cool. 77 % away from Tinder pages answer a fit contained in this 30 moments, and you will 40 % act within 5 minutes. Credibility is also the upper checklist regarding what young daters require. 78 percent off Gen Z surveyed told you it prioritise admiration in lovers, which have 79 % prizing loyalty due to the fact an important quality and you will 61 % valuing discover-mindedness. At the same time, 56 percent prioritised physical appearance. 80 per cent off 18-twenty-five year olds say their unique worry about-care and attention is their main said when relationship, and 79 percent wanted their possible couples and then make a top priority of one’s own well being too. Almost 75 % off younger single say they pick a complement more desirable if they’re accessible to focusing on its intellectual well-being. #tinder #datingapps #genz #research #technology

“Anyone fundamentally have no idea ideas on how to look for items that cannot exist but really, which means you have to believe in your self.” A powerful line regarding Whitney Wolfe Herd provides left a powerful perception with the me ever since. Without a doubt a narrative away from their particular become this new youngest woman Millionaire. ________________________________ Whitney Wolfe Herd used to be new founding person in Tinder. She left the fresh new DateRussianGirl mobil relationships application business Tinder and a keen abusive matchmaking inside 2014, Whitney Wolfe Herd is determined which will make a strengthening matchmaking experience for females. Wolfe Herd produces on Bumble’s webpages. “I thought, ‘What if I will flip one on their direct? Let’s say feminine generated the original move and you will delivered the initial content?’” Staying one to envision planned, In , Wolfe Herd, together with relationship software Badoo co-inventor Andrey Andreev and previous Tinder professionals Chris Gulzcynski and you may Sarah Mick, released an internet dating application that needs women to make the very first move around in heterosexual suits. It’s Bumble. The company took off-mainly toward college campuses-and also the software reached 100,000 packages in its first few days. She implemented some of the most well known actions. One of them pricing simply 20 bucks. They sent pizzas value 20 cash that have Bumble signal shapes towards the them to university girls, asking these to obtain Bumble. This provided these to keeps an enormous rise in packages. Since , Bumble keeps an industry cover off $2.85 Million. According to the studies, this makes Bumble the latest world’s 3479th best team of the industry cover.
